Output 41eb11d0e85cce9067475faed832ab9962db8d216020d23635038db28596ff57:14

value
684907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d915d61a6d1b4272456e0fe16247da6ca3f118d0 OP_EQUAL
address
3MUriPNTuYgpeJXcfVuC6LLSTpUKQLXfAF
transaction
41eb11d0e85cce9067475faed832ab9962db8d216020d23635038db28596ff57
confirmations
330676
spent
true